0

OpenClaw Windows 一键部署完整指南:从零开始搭建本地AI助手

2026.06.06 | youres | 23次围观

为什么选择OpenClaw作为本地AI助手

在众多AI工具中,OpenClaw凭借其开源特性和强大的自动化能力脱颖而出。与依赖云服务的AI助手不同,OpenClaw让你完全掌控数据流,所有信息处理都在本地完成,从根本上保障隐私安全。

我初次接触OpenClaw是在一个紧急项目中,需要频繁处理敏感数据且不能依赖外部API。经过三个月的深度使用,我发现它的价值远超预期——不仅是聊天工具,更是能真正执行任务的"数字员工"。

部署前的环境准备

成功的部署始于充分准备。根据我的实践经验,以下检查点能避免90%的常见问题:

  • 系统版本确认:Windows 10/11 21H2或更高版本,确保系统组件兼容性
  • 内存预留:建议16GB以上可用内存,AI模型运行需要充足资源
  • 磁盘空间:预留至少10GB空间,用于存放模型文件和依赖项
  • 网络环境:稳定的网络连接用于初始下载,后续可离线使用

一键部署的实战步骤

OpenClaw的一键部署包极大简化了安装流程,但细节决定成败。以下是经过多次验证的标准流程:

第一步:获取官方部署包

访问OpenClaw官方网站或GitHub Releases页面,下载最新版本的Windows部署包。建议选择稳定版而非测试版,除非你需要特定新功能。

下载完成后,务必验证文件完整性。我曾因下载不完整导致安装失败,浪费了大量调试时间。检查文件哈希值或使用压缩软件测试压缩包完整性。

第二步:解压与权限配置

将部署包解压到不含中文和空格的路径,例如 D:OpenClaw。这个细节常被忽略,却导致无数"无法启动"的问题。

右键点击解压后的文件夹,选择"属性" → "安全",确认当前用户有完全控制权限。如果遇到权限问题,可以右键以管理员身份运行安装脚本。

第三步:执行自动化安装

双击运行 install.batsetup.exe(具体文件名因版本而异)。安装程序会自动处理以下任务:

# 安装过程会自动执行:
1. 检测Node.js环境,缺失时自动安装
2. 配置Python虚拟环境
3. 下载基础AI模型(可选跳过)
4. 注册系统服务以实现开机自启
5. 配置防火墙规则允许本地访问

整个流程约需5-15分钟,取决于网络速度和硬件性能。我建议在安装期间不要进行其他高负载操作,以免影响安装质量。

常见部署问题深度解析

即使按照教程操作,仍可能遇到意外情况。以下是我在实战中总结的问题解决思路:

问题现象 可能原因 解决方案
安装脚本闪退 PowerShell执行策略限制 以管理员运行:Set-ExecutionPolicy RemoteSigned
模型下载失败 网络连接或代理配置 检查防火墙设置,或手动下载模型文件放到指定目录
服务无法启动 端口冲突或权限不足 修改配置文件中的端口号,或以管理员身份运行
Web界面无法访问 浏览器缓存或HTTPS证书 清除浏览器缓存,或添加证书例外(自用环境)

部署后的关键配置

安装完成只是开始,合理的配置才能让OpenClaw发挥真正威力。以下几个配置项建议优先处理:

模型选择策略

OpenClaw支持多种AI模型,选择时需权衡性能与资源消耗:

  • 轻量级任务:选择7B以下参数的模型,响应快、资源占用低
  • 复杂推理:使用13B+参数的模型,精度更高但需要更多内存
  • 中文优化:优先考虑在中文语料上微调的模型,如ChatGLM、Qwen等

安全配置要点

虽然是本地部署,安全配置仍不可忽视:

  1. 设置访问密码,防止未授权使用
  2. 配置IP白名单,限制可访问的设备
  3. 定期备份配置和对话历史
  4. 关注安全更新,及时升级到修复漏洞的版本

性能优化实战经验

部署只是第一步,让OpenClaw流畅运行需要一些调优技巧。这些经验来自实际部署案例:

内存管理:AI模型对内存需求较大,建议设置交换文件作为缓冲。在32GB内存的机器上,我通常分配8GB交换空间,确保在高负载时系统不会卡死。

并发控制:默认配置可能允许过多并发请求,导致响应变慢。通过修改配置文件中的max_concurrent参数,将并发数限制在CPU核心数的2倍以内,能显著提升响应速度。

模型加载策略:如果内存有限,可以配置按需加载模型,而非启动时全部加载。虽然首次查询会稍慢,但能大幅降低内存占用。

从部署到实际应用

完成部署后,OpenClaw能做什么?以下是我实际使用中的高价值场景:

  • 代码辅助:解释复杂代码逻辑,生成单元测试,甚至重构优化
  • 文档处理:总结长文档要点,提取结构化信息,翻译技术资料
  • 自动化脚本:根据需求描述生成PowerShell、Python等脚本
  • 知识管理:构建个人知识库,通过问答快速检索历史信息

最重要的是,所有这些功能都在本地运行,无需担心数据泄露风险。对于处理敏感信息的企业和个人,这是云端AI无法替代的优势。

持续维护与升级

部署不是一次性工作,合理的维护能让系统长期稳定运行:

定期检查更新,但不要在关键项目期间升级。我通常等待新版本发布1-2周,确认社区反馈稳定后再更新。同时,保持模型文件的备份,因为重新下载可能需要大量时间和流量。

日志监控也很关键。OpenClaw的日志文件通常位于安装目录的logs文件夹,定期查看能提前发现潜在问题,如内存泄漏、异常崩溃等。

总结与展望

OpenClaw的Windows一键部署大大降低了本地AI助手的使用门槛。通过本文的详细指南,你应该能顺利完成部署并避开常见陷阱。

随着AI技术的快速发展,本地部署的AI工具将变得更强大、更易用。掌握这类工具的部署和使用,不仅提升当前工作效率,更是为未来AI全面融入工作流程做好准备。

如果在部署过程中遇到本文未涵盖的问题,欢迎在评论区交流讨论。实践出真知,每个部署案例都在丰富这个开源生态。

版权声明

本文仅代表个人观点。
本文系AI辅助作者原创,未经许可,转载请保留原文链接。

发表评论